What are the responsibilities and job description for the Director of Development - Corporate Relations position at Texas A&M Foundation?

Brief Description

The Director of Development for the Office of Corporate Relations serves as a strategic leader in advancing the Foundation’s corporate engagement and philanthropic goals. This position is responsible for designing and executing comprehensive fundraising and partnership initiatives that support the office’s mission, research priorities, and collaborative opportunities across Texas A&M University. The Director of Development will cultivate and steward relationships with corporate partners, donors, and stakeholders to secure major gifts, sponsorships, and strategic investments, while working closely with Foundation leadership, university administrators, and advancement teams. This role requires a dynamic, relationship-focused professional with a deep understanding of corporate philanthropy and a proven track record in development strategy and partner engagement.

What you’ll do…

Role

As the Director of Development, you will serve as an ambassador of the Texas A&M Foundation and Texas A&M University, uniting donor generosity with the university’s vision to shape a better future. In this leadership role, you will:

  • Develop and implement strategic corporate engagement and fundraising plans aligned with the Foundation’s priorities and Texas A&M’s mission.
  • Build and manage a portfolio of corporate partners and prospects, cultivating relationships that lead to impactful philanthropic and strategic support.
  • Solicit gifts, sponsorships, and investments at major and principal levels to advance Texas A&M and the Foundation’s corporate relations objectives.
  • Collaborate with university leadership and corporate stakeholders to identify partnership opportunities and communicate them effectively.
  • Lead stewardship efforts to ensure corporate partners feel valued and informed about the impact of their engagement and giving.
  • Mentor and guide development staff, fostering a culture of collaboration, innovation, and excellence in corporate engagement.
  • Represent the Foundation and the Office of Corporate Relations at events, meetings, and partner engagements to strengthen relationships and visibility.

What we require…

  • Bachelor’s degree or equivalent combination of education and experience.
  • Minimum of 3 years of fundraising experience, including major gift solicitation.
  • Proven ability to develop and execute strategic fundraising plans.
  • Strong leadership, communication, and relationship-building skills.
  • Commitment to the mission and vision of the Texas A&M Foundation.

We’d love to find someone with…

  • Master’s degree.
  • 5 years of progressive development experience.
  • Certified Fundraising Executive (CFRE) or comparable certification.
  • Experience in nonprofit or higher education sectors.
  • Demonstrated success in securing principal gifts and managing high-level donor relationships.
